Over the weekend, nine competitors, three coaches and six volunteers from Discovery Riders participated in the 2016 Special Olympics Ohio State Equestrian Competition at the Winton Woods Riding Center in Cincinnati.
Special Olympics Equestrian encompasses several disciplines during the two-day event. Riders choose either English or Western tack and enter the appropriate classes of showmanship, western barrel racing and western working trail.
Discovery riders earned several honors with T.J. Grose of Union County winning gold in Western barrel racing.
